Output db4f5b4946220504337386f77cb1300f5f0508cb3dbf127b69311b0e38aa857f:4

value
14429234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6a65754238aad36811df97368f389cf14416bd0 OP_EQUAL
address
3NiacFPbs4gnWEE9b755GMS6RRwJAXKV8C
transaction
db4f5b4946220504337386f77cb1300f5f0508cb3dbf127b69311b0e38aa857f
confirmations
277708
spent
true